Roman (67) and Macky (56), two friends from Vienna, Austria, surprised the villagers in Thailand’s rural Buriram province by marrying 37-year-old Dujduan Ketsaro. The unique ceremony, held on February 28, was described as a “first-time” wedding as a woman took the vows of matrimony with two men.

Dujduan is the mother of three children and was previously married to a Thai husband, but they separated due to financial problems. After this he worked in Pattaya, where he met Roman. Roman had come to visit Thailand at that time. Both lived together for about five years. Later, Roman’s friend Macky also came to Thailand and he also became close to Dujduan. Roman says that he was aware of his friend’s feelings and did not want to break their years-old friendship because of a woman. For this reason, all three decided to live together with mutual understanding. After living in this arrangement for about a year, with the blessings of Dujduan’s family, they held a formal marriage ceremony.
People were surprised to see the wedding
Duzduan’s mother Guang, 61, said she has seen her daughter struggle a lot in life and is now happy that she has found friends to support her. According to him, what the society thinks is not as important as his daughter’s happiness and the secure future of his children. He said that mutual love and understanding is more important than dowry. Salengthon sub-district municipality mayor Thienyu Luangdechanurak also attended the wedding. He said that he has seen many marriages, but this was the first time that he saw a woman marrying two men simultaneously. He wished the newlyweds and said that may their love last for a long time. It is noteworthy that polygamy was legal in Thailand till 1935, but it was later abolished.
